About Madison
Madison Bell is building a broad litigation practice at the firm. Before joining, she clerked for Justice John Norris of the Federal Court, assisting on administrative, constitutional, immigration, and national security files, including several high-profile matters, and she also gained commercial litigation experience at a mid-sized Toronto firm. She obtained her J.D. from the University of Ottawa in 2024, graduating cum laude, and worked as a research assistant examining the limits of lawful protest during her studies. She also provided legislative support to a Canadian senator and contributed to counter-terrorism programming while working with Global Affairs Canada. She holds a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in political science from Brock University, graduating with first class standing, and was called to the Ontario bar in 2025.
